Shaw gets sportier with addition of TSN Go, Sportsnet Now

Shaw_logo_RGB.jpg

CALGARY – Just in time for the start of the NHL and NBA seasons, Shaw has added TSN Go and Sportsnet Now to its TV Everywhere offering.

Available on iOS and Android devices, TSN Go will give Shaw Cable and Shaw Direct subscribers on the go access to the TSN feeds they subscribe to, including the ability to view live and on-demand content. The app will also allow for live audio streaming of TSN Radio's all-sports stations in Edmonton, Winnipeg, Toronto, Ottawa, Vancouver and Montreal.

Shaw customers who subscribe to TSN's suite of feeds in their cable and satellite packages can download the app by visiting shaw.ca/shawgo or shawdirect.ca/shawgo, or by visiting TSN Go online at www.TSN.ca/GO

Through Sportsnet Now, Shaw Cable and Shaw Direct customers will gain instant access to live, streaming content from all the Sportsnet channels they subscribe to, including Sportsnet Ontario, East, West and Pacific, Sportsnet One, Sportsnet 360, and Sportsnet World.  Sportsnet viewers in Vancouver, Calgary, Edmonton, Toronto and Montreal will also get access to regional NHL games on the app, which is available on iOS and Android devices or online through users' Internet browser.

The Sportsnet Now app will also allow users to create notification reminders for upcoming live events, pause and rewind content after first airing, and – through Internet browser usage – the ability to watch up to four Sportsnet channels at once.  Customers who subscribe to Sportsnet in their cable or satellite package can download the app or view content online by visiting www.sportsnet.ca/now
